WebMoss does not require soil but does need stable support, moisture, and moderate shade to grow. Moss is a type of plant that is often found in shady, moist areas, and unlike other plants, moss doesn’t use roots to grow and spread. Instead, it has threadlike structures called rhizoids that are used to anchor the plant to its growing surface.

WebAug 18, 2024 · Sphagnum moss is commonly used when growing succulents or orchids indoors. It is light and holds moisture very well. It doesn't become overly soggy though, so it means your plant is less likely to be bothered by root rot issues. Having a wide range of plants in your lawn increases its value to wildlife. geometry activities for 2nd gradeWebMoss does grow on the north side of trees, and it also grows on the south, east, and west sides of trees, as well. Moss may grow only on a north side of a tree if that’s the shadiest location as the sun tracks the sky.
